No problem—there are plenty of other household ingredients that can help deodorize a fridge, and even get rid of … WebWill freezing ground coffee keep it fresh? As a “rule of thumb,” frozen ground coffee can last and keep its freshness for up to two years if the coffee has been vacuum-sealed, but not more than six months if it has not. And when not frozen (e.g., for in-pantry storage), vacuum-sealed coffee can keep its freshness for five to six months.
